UNDERSTANDING THE CHILD WITH Sickle Cell Disease

WebCOMMON MEDICAL COMPLICATIONS OF SICKLE CELL DISEASE Sickle Cell disease causes the red blood cells to become abnormal. Some red blood cells lose their oxygen, become sticky and stiff, and become shaped like a sickle or ‘c’. The sickled cells do not move through the blood stream easily and can cause problems in multiple body systems. WebSickle cell disease is a group of blood disorders that prevent the normal flow of blood in the body because of the effect on the hemoglobin within red blood cells. Hemoglobin is the main ingredient in red blood cells, helping them carry oxygen from the lungs to other parts of the body. Normal red blood cells have hemoglobin A, which helps keep ...
